Gibson broke into the majors with the Twins in 2013 and eventually pitched seven seasons for Minnesota. In his Twins career, Gibson had 67 wins and a 4.52 ERA in more than 1,000 innings. He would add on stints with the Rangers, Phillies, Orioles and Cardinals.
Derek Falvey arrived in Minnesota from the Guardians' front office, a system known for maximizing pitching and churning the roster efficiently. Manager Rocco Baldelli came from the Rays, where roster manipulation and deadline boldness are basically a front-office tradition.
